Can you leave food in aluminum pan?

Lightweight aluminum is an excellent heat conductor, but it’s also highly reactive with acidic foods such as tomatoes, vinegar, and citrus juice. Such items can cause aluminum to leach into food, altering its flavor and appearance and leaving the cookware with a pitted surface.

Why should you not store food in metal containers? Storing food in metal pots is not recommended as some metals can leach into the food. Leaching happens when metal from the pot interacts with acids in food, which leads to the food being discolored and tainted with metal. Stainless steel cooking pots are the least likely to leach into foods.

Is it safe to freeze food in metal containers?

Metal is great in the freezer. You can put opened cans of food directly into the freezer (it’s safer than storing food in a can in the refrigerator). Use metal ice cube trays, muffin tins, or bread tins to freeze smaller quantities of food; then transfer to a container or wrap well for longer-term storage.

Is it safe to store food in open cans?

Storing open food cans in your fridge won’t cause food poisoning or botulism, but it will affect the taste. The only time you could get food poisoning is if the can shows tangible signs of damage like foul-smelling contents, dents, leaks or bulges.

Can I store rice in Mason jars?

Glass jars are a surprisingly good container for packaging dry goods such as; wheat, white rice, rolled oats, sugar, salt, and corn in your long term food storage. The great advantage of using glass is that it creates a true oxygen and moisture barrier. Also, glass does not leach toxins into the food.

How do you store pasta?

Store dry, uncooked pasta in a cool, dry place like your pantry for up to one year. Preserve freshness by storing dry pasta in an air-tight box or container. Follow the first-in, first-out rule: use up packages you’ve had longest before opening new ones.

How do you store oats?

Unopened dry oatmeal should be stored in a cool, clean and dry place. Opened oatmeal ought to be stored tightly covered in a resealable plastic bag or in a plastic or glass container. It is best practice to use opened oatmeal within one year. Dry oatmeal can also be stored in a freezer bag in the freezer for one year.

How long do canned carrots last after opening?

CARROTS, COMMERCIALLY CANNED OR BOTTLED — OPENED

To maximize the shelf life of canned carrots after opening, refrigerate in covered glass or plastic container. How long do opened canned carrots last in the refrigerator? Canned carrots that have been continuously refrigerated will keep for about 3 to 4 days.

Does aluminium leach into food?

Aluminium is significantly more likely to leach into food, and at higher levels, in acidic and liquid food solutions like lemon and tomato juice than in those containing alcohol or salt. Leaching levels climb even more when spice is added to food that’s cooked in aluminium foil.
